debian

在Debian上部署JSP应用需要注意哪些兼容性问题

小樊
42
2025-06-05 09:18:55
栏目: 编程语言

在Debian上部署JSP应用时,可能会遇到一些兼容性问题。以下是一些需要注意的关键点:

1. Java版本

确保安装了兼容的Java版本。JSP应用通常需要Java Servlet容器(如Apache Tomcat)来运行,而Tomcat对Java版本有一定的要求。例如,Tomcat 9需要Java 8或更高版本。

2. Tomcat版本

选择合适的Tomcat版本。不同版本的Tomcat可能对JSP的支持程度不同,需要根据应用的需求选择合适的版本。同时,要确保Tomcat与Debian系统兼容,可以参考Tomcat官方文档中的系统要求。

3. 依赖库

检查并安装所有必要的依赖库。JSP应用可能依赖于一些Java库,这些库需要在部署前确保已经安装在Tomcat的lib目录下。

4. 配置文件

正确配置Tomcat的配置文件(如server.xml、context.xml等),以确保应用能够正确运行。特别是端口配置、SSL配置等。

5. 权限设置

确保应用文件和目录的权限设置正确。在Debian上,通常使用chownchmod命令来设置文件和目录的所有者和权限。

6. 日志和监控

配置日志和监控,以便在应用出现问题时能够快速定位和解决。Tomcat提供了详细的日志文件,可以通过配置日志级别来监控应用的运行情况。

7. 安全性

注意应用的安全性,防止常见的安全漏洞,如文件下载漏洞等。可以通过配置安全策略、更新软件版本等方式来提高应用的安全性。

以上是在Debian上部署JSP应用时需要注意的一些兼容性问题。建议在部署前详细阅读相关软件的官方文档,并根据具体需求进行相应的配置和调整。

0
看了该问题的人还看了